What is Atenolol?

Atenolol Stada is a beta-blocker used to manage heart-related conditions. This oral medication helps regulate heart rate and blood pressure, offering a reliable solution for cardiovascular health.

What is Atenolol used for?

Atenolol Stada is commonly used to treat high blood pressure (hypertension) and angina (chest pain). It works by blocking beta-adrenergic receptors, which helps to lower heart rate and blood pressure. People often ask, 'What is Atenolol used for?' and the answer includes managing heart rhythm disorders and preventing heart attacks.

What are the side effects of Atenolol?

Common effects of Atenolol Stada may include fatigue, dizziness, and cold hands or feet. Some users also report experiencing shortness of breath or a slower heart rate. These effects can vary from person to person and may subside as the body adjusts to the medication.

What precautions apply to Atenolol?

Atenolol Stada should be handled with care, especially by individuals with asthma, diabetes, or certain heart conditions. It is important to follow the advice of a healthcare professional regarding its use. Always store the medication in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ight.

What does Atenolol interact with?

Atenolol Stada may interact with other medications, including certain antidepressants, calcium channel blockers, and nonsteroidal anti-inflammatory drugs (NSAIDs). It is also advisable to avoid alcohol while taking this medication, as it can enhance some of the side effects. Always consult a healthcare provider before combining Atenolol with other treatments.
